The Resveratrol Compound and what’s Referred to As the French Paradox Researched By Scientists.

The resveratrol compound has been linked to numerous different positive benefits on our body over the most recent decade. There have been hundreds of research tests conducted completed demonstrating different effects to the molecule, which is found naturally in grapes among various kinds of flora. But can resveratrol also make sense of the French Paradox?

Resveratrol

You may be asking yourself what the French Paradox is. It is a phrase that has been used to reference the surprisingly low occurrence of serious heart ailments in countries such as France, even though the normal dietary intake in the region being extremely heavy on seemingly unhealthy saturated fat. This is clearly in opposition to the widely held thinking that diets heavy in fat result in coronary heart ailments including elevated blood pressure and cholesterol, heart blockages and more.

The French Paradox has also been linked to a few other regions, such as Italy, Spain and Greece. What is the universal factor with these places? It is their high consumption of lots of red wine and red wine specifically may house the answer to the whole paradox.

Red wine specifically houses large quantities of resveratrol, which has been found to offer numerous amazing effects. One of the foremost supporters on resveratrol, David Sinclair, completed an experiment on mice which showed that lab rats eating high levels of resveratrol suffered no harmful results from a large in saturated fat diet whereas other lab rats in the study suffered various unhealthy consequences. Adding to that, resveratrol has been found to provide results that are identical to a calorie restriction program, and may actually increase a person’s life expectancy.

Considering the research claims that show that resveratrol prevents the unhealthy effects of a large in saturated fat nutritional program, and the inclusion of resveratrol in red wine, an obvious line can be made between resveratrol and the French Paradox itself. The resveratrol compound is accordingly reasoned to be responsible for the French Paradox and the typically positive lifespans of people from a handful of Mediterranean places even considering their high fat eating patterns.

More studies have to be performed on the subject however, as no solid tying together has 100% proven. Some doctors actually believe that the French Paradox doesn’t occur, and that coronary heart illnesses are under reported in these places. Others believe that saturated fat doesn’t have clear connections to coronary heart diseases. However, there is an increasing collection of experiments that show the coronary healthy benefits of resveratrol. Seeing how it’s so commonly found in wine in places linked to the French Paradox, it should be viewed seriously.

Therefore resveratrol is obviously linked to the mystery that is the French Paradox. When more tests are finished, a more all inclusive viewing will be achieved not only for resveratrol, but for the whole French Paradox and how the two things are intertwined.
